"This disc, recorded at the 19th-century Museum of Water in Lisbon, compares and contrasts three essential Renaissance musical styles. There’s Lassus’s magnificent parody of Gombert’s chanson, the Missa Tous les regretz, a virtuoso work exploring contrasts of texture, pace, idea, mood. There’s Palestrina’s Missa Ut re mi fa sol la, music of affectingly sophisticated purity, based on a simple upward scale. And, between, there’s Thomas Ashewell’s Missa “Ave Maria” – a glorious instance of exuberant late-gothic flowering in which the plainchant underpins otherwise free-flowing fantasy. Van Nevel relishes the different sensualities of each work, and the singing of the Huelgas Ensemble is beautifully blended and sonorous." - Stephen Pettitt, Sunday Times, 13 January 2008

"The concept is simple: three Renaissance Masses in three styles – Roman, Franco-Flemish and English. But the pleasure is deep and rare, thanks to the superlative art of Paul Van Nevel’s Huelgas Ensemble. We start with the earthy counterpoint of Lassus; then comes the Thomas Ashewell, a master of the decorative. Finally, Palestrina lifts us to paradise with music of grave purity. A ravishing collection." - Geoff Brown, The Times, 18 January 2008
